About The Position

The Data Analyst will apply industry knowledge to creatively analyze data and drive project and studio improvements using statistical methods. This role involves leading complex analytics projects, leveraging data warehousing, architecture, modeling, and ETL processes with tools like SparkSQL and Python to create scalable data views. The analyst will utilize advanced analytics techniques, including statistical simulations and machine learning algorithms (e.g., logistic regression, boosted trees, random forest), to generate intelligence, predict player gaming behavior, and evaluate feature performance. Key responsibilities include extracting and analyzing complex datasets to understand game metrics, inform hypotheses, and design analytical experiments. The position also requires performing ad hoc analysis to identify patterns in player behavior, measure feature performance, support user acquisition, and resolve data issues using R, Python, Excel, and SparkSQL. The analyst will identify and implement operational improvements in data tasks and processes, create and distribute data and insights through regular and ad-hoc reports using platforms like Tableau, Excel, and SQL, and collaborate with executives and managers to clarify objectives and solve problems. Additionally, the role involves formulating mathematical or simulation models to improve game performance and communicating complex statistical findings to various stakeholders for decision-making.
